DraftKings Quarterbacks - Week 17 DFS Picks

Jared Goff - CHI @ DET ($5,600)

Thought by many to be a bridge QB for the rebuilding Lions, Jared Goff has outperformed all expectations in 2022. Goff has passed for 3,959 yards and 26 TDs while throwing just seven picks for an offense that's averaging 26.1 points per game.

He ranks ninth at the QB position in total DraftKings points scored this year. Goff and this Lions' passing attack draw a prime matchup in the cushy domed environment of Ford Field against a talentless Chicago Bears defense that's been pasted across the board. The Bears stand dead last in the NFL in Total Defense DVOA.

Mike White - NYJ @ SEA ($5,400)

With Zach Wilson booed into oblivion by New York's home crowd last Thursday night, Mike White will return to the lineup for this matchup against the Seattle Seahawks. White has been on the shelf for two weeks with a rib injury but should be all systems go for Week 17 at a bargain basement price of just $5.4k.

He provided a noticeable spark for a sluggish Jets offense during his earlier stint at the helm this year, passing for 952 yards and three TDs while averaging 20.3 DraftKings points per game across his three starts. White will have a good chance to resume his success against the Seattle Seahawks in Week 17. Seattle rates just 21st in the NFL in Pass Defense DVOA and have allowed opposing QBs to throw 22 TDs this season.

 

DraftKings Running Backs - Week 17 DFS Picks

James Conner - ARI @ ATL ($7,200)

It's been all James Conner all the time for the ailing Cardinals. With Kyler Murray done for the year and the organization seemingly at a crossroads, Arizona has had little choice but to lean on their RB1 over recent weeks. The usage has been ridiculous. Since Week 10, Conner has garnered a crazy 92% snap share, the highest in the NFL for a running back by a wide margin.

He's averaged 21.7 touches over Arizona's last six and that extreme volume has led to production, as Conner has averaged 21.4 DraftKings points over the team's last six games, topping 23 DK points on four occasions. While veteran Colt McCoy is expected to be back under center for Arizona this week, we can expect their run-heavy approach to continue against an Atlanta Falcons squad that's struggled against the run. Atlanta has allowed the seventh-most rushing yards (1,612) in the NFL to the RB position this season.

Travis Etienne - JAX @ HOU ($6,400) 

Attacking Houston on the ground has been a very profitable strategy in 2022, so we'll go back to the well with Jacksonville's dynamic RB Travis Etienne. The Clemson product has dominated the usage in this backfield down the stretch, averaging a massive 77% snap share over the past month, which is the fifth-highest RB share in the NFL over that timeframe.

He'll wield that volume this week against a Texans run defense that's statistically been the worst in the NFL in 2022. Houston has allowed the league's most rushing yards, TDs, and fantasy points to the RB position this year.

DraftKings Wide Receivers - Week 17 DFS Picks

Garrett Wilson - NYJ @ SEA ($5,500)

Put simply, Garrett Wilson has been an elite receiver when anyone other than Zach Wilson is under center for the New York Jets. That's why Mike White's return to the lineup this week should mean big things for the talented Jets receiver.

The first-round rookie formed a terrific duo with White earlier this year. In his two full games with White, Wilson averaged 26.8 DraftKings points combining for 257 receiving yards and two TDs across Weeks 11 and 12. As a bonus, Wilson's DraftKings price tag is now at its lowest point in nearly a month. He'll square off against a Seattle Seahawks defense that's been middling at best against opposing pass catchers. The Seahawks grade out 21st in the league in Pass Defense DVOA this year.

Brandin Cooks - JAX @ HOU ($4,800)

It's been a frustrating season all the way around for Brandin Cooks, as the talented receiver has been frustrated with the Houston organization and has been in and out of the Texans' lineup as a result. Cooks returned from a four-week absence last week and wasted little time re-establishing himself as the alpha in this receiving corps.

Cooks stepped right into a sizable workload against the Titan in Week 16. He logged a 76% snap share and garnered a significant 30% team targets share, which resulted in four catches on nine targets for 34 yards and a score. He'll be on the field and he'll be drawing plenty of targets against a Jags squad that's allowed the NFL's third-most receiving TDs (18) to the WR position in 2022.

 

DraftKings Tight Ends - Week 17 DFS Picks

T.J. Hockenson - MIN @ GB ($5,400)

I've been banging the Hockenson drum for what feels like forever - including in this article last week - and we finally got our blowup game against the Giants. Hock dropped a sizzling 13/109/2 line on New York in Week 16. Thanks to his elite underlying metrics, the party doesn't have to stop now.

Since landing in Minny on a trade deadline deal, the big tight end's usage has been off the charts. He leads the TE position in total Air Yards while ranking second to just Travis Kelce in targets and yards since he put on the purple. His Week 17 matchup against the Packers isn't an especially great one, but we simply can't ignore Hockenson's volume at this point, especially when he comes in at $2,700 cheaper than Kelce on this slate.

Evan Engram - JAX @ HOU ($4,400)

Despite being the position's top fantasy scorer over the past month, Evan Engram's DK price is still lingering in the mid-$4k range. He feels like a no-brainer here against a lowly Houston Texans squad that's struggled in most every defensive area and has relinquished 799 receiving yards to opposing TEs this season.

Engram has simply been on a tear of late and has looked like the player that we always thought he could be during his time in New York. He's gone over 100 receiving yards in two of Jacksonville's last three and totaled a ridiculous 367 yards and three scores on 31 catches over the Jags' last four. Engram has been targeted 40 (!) times since Week 13. His volume and production make him a lock-button cash-game play for me on this slate.
